The Aerodynamic Paradox: 26cm Long, Only 49g!

When you forge a weapon that is 26 centimeters long, you expect it to be a heavy wrist-breaker. For context, our Master Sword is 28cm long and weighs a massive 183g.

Yet, the Windcleaver tips the scales at a shockingly light 49 grams. Let's look at the forge data:

Long Sword Relics Physical Length Gram Weight Blade Engineering
Windcleaver 26.0 cm 49 g ! Slender Katana with Split-Spine Cutout
Master Sword 28.0 cm 183 g Solid, Thick Broadsword
Zora Sword 21.0 cm 97 g Solid, Streamlined Ingot

An adult hand holding the 26cm Zelda Windcleaver miniature, demonstrating the impressive length of the Yiga Clan katana against a desert diorama background.

Look at the handheld scale shot above. The sword stretches entirely across the forearm. The secret to its 49g agility is the extreme negative space. The blade is essentially split down the middle, creating a long hollow channel designed to literally "cleave the wind" and send vacuums of pressurized air at enemies. Casting this massive hollow gap in zinc alloy without the fragile katana tip snapping requires masterful mold-cooling techniques.


The Blacksmith’s Q&A: Honesty in Materials

Our buyers appreciate total transparency from the forge. Here is what you need to know about the materials used in this $19.99 set:

  • Is the blade real metal?

    • Yes. The blade, the crossguard, and the crimson wrapped hilt are 100% solid, cold zinc alloy.

  • Is the black scabbard also metal?

    • No, the scabbard is high-density molded plastic. Why? Two reasons. First, a metal scabbard of this length would completely throw off the balance of the display. Second, and most importantly, sliding a metal katana in and out of a metal scabbard would instantly scratch and destroy the beautiful silver electroplating on the blade. The plastic scabbard protects your artifact.
